transmit(self: mtf.libs.mtf_pybinder.bap.BAPFSG, fct_id_or_name: int | str, op_code: mtf.libs.mtf_pybinder.bap.BAPOpCode, payload: list[int] = []) mtf.libs.mtf_pybinder.bap.BAPResult

Transmit FSG message with the given parameters.

Note: In case of Property, it is better to use update_payload method.

Args:

fct_id_or_name (str|int): Function ID or name. op_code (BAPOpCode): Operation code. payload (list[int]): The data payload, consisting of unsigned 8-bit integers.

Return:

BAPResult: The result of the operation.

transmit_unchecked(self: mtf.libs.mtf_pybinder.bap.BAPFSG, fct_id_or_name: int | str, op_code: mtf.libs.mtf_pybinder.bap.BAPOpCode, payload: list[int] = []) mtf.libs.mtf_pybinder.bap.BAPResult

Transmit FSG message with the given parameters. No checks for payload length and op_code.

Args:

fct_id_or_name (str|int): Function ID or name. op_code (int): Operation code. payload (list[int]): The data payload, consisting of unsigned 8-bit integers.

Return:

BAPResult: The result of the operation.

update_payload(self: mtf.libs.mtf_pybinder.bap.BAPFSG, fct_id_or_name: int | str, payload: list[int]) mtf.libs.mtf_pybinder.bap.BAPResult

Update the payload of a property function. It will retrigger the heartbeat mechanism and send the function with STATUS OpCode.

Args:

fct_id_or_name (str|int): Function ID or name. payload (list[int]): The new payload data, consisting of unsigned 8-bit integers.

Return:

BAPResult: The result of the operation.

class mtf.libs.mtf_pybinder.bap.BAPFSGStartupConfig

BAP FSG startup config class

__init__(self: mtf.libs.mtf_pybinder.bap.BAPFSGStartupConfig) None
__new__(**kwargs)
property function_list

Optional subset of functions to activate. Defaults all activated.

property send_bap_config_reset

Whether to send config reset or not. Defaults True.

property start_heartbeat_mechanism

Whether to start heartbeat mechanism or not. Defaults True.

property use_statusall_to_reply_to_getall

Whether to reply with status_all to get_all or not. Defaults True.
